Firefox:
- First type "about:config" in address bar in Firefox browser.
- Here under “Preference Name” search for "security.tls.version.max".
- In front of "security.tls.version.max" you will find “Value” field where you have to enter 3.
- With the value of 3 your TLS version TLSv1.3 is enabled now.
- NOTE: Make sure you are using Firefox 23.0 or higher version of it.
